Mining News Pro - The Islamic Republic of Iran officially announced a ban on the export of sponge iron to all its customs.
In the letter of the Director General of the Customs Office of the Islamic Republic of Iran to the Customs of all over the country: Since August 04 this year, the export of sponge iron is prohibited under tariffs 72031000 and 72039000.
The letter reads: According to the above mentioned provisions, the export of items by their manufacturers is possible after obtaining a license from the Ministry of Education.
